A tsunami is a shallow water wave typically caused by seismic activities underneath the ocean. While inconspicuous in deep water, tsunamis become significantly larger and more dangerous as they reach shallower coastal waters.
Explanation:
A tsunami is considered to be a shallow water wave. These waves are commonly initiated by disturbances such as undersea earthquakes, landslides, or volcanic eruptions. When in deep ocean, a tsunami's height can be less than 30 cm, allowing it to travel at speeds up to 700 km/h largely unnoticed. As it approaches the coast and enters shallower waters, its speed decreases, and it grows substantially in height due to the energy being compressed into a smaller column of water. The Indian Ocean tsunami of 2004, caused by an immensely powerful earthquake, is an example of the devastating effects when a tsunami reaches populated coastlines.

The Primary Cause of Earth's Seasons
The primary cause of Earth's seasons is the inclination of Earth's rotational axis. The axis is not perpendicular to the orbital plane; instead, it is tilted at an angle of approximately 23.5 degrees, which is known as Earth's obliquity. This tilt results in different parts of the Earth receiving varying amounts of sunlight throughout the year, which in turn creates the seasons.
During the Earth's orbit around the Sun, the Northern Hemisphere leans towards the Sun for part of the year, resulting in longer days, more direct sunlight, and hence, summer. In contrast, in the other part of the year, the Southern Hemisphere leans towards the Sun, leading to summer in the Southern Hemisphere and winter in the Northern Hemisphere. Therefore, it's not the changing distance from the Sun that causes seasons, since Earth's orbit only changes the distance from the Sun by about 3%, which is insufficient to explain the significant temperature changes associated with different seasons.
It is a common misconception that seasons are due to Earth's elliptical orbit around the Sun. In reality, both hemispheres experience opposite seasons simultaneously, which cannot be explained by the Earth-Sun distance model, but is explained by the Earth's axial tilt.

What is Cleavage in minerals?Cleavage is the propensity of minerals to split along crystallographic planes, resulting in planes of relative weakness. This is caused by the structural locations of atoms and ions in the crystal.
To determine the angle of cleavage, look at the intersection of the cleavage planes. Cleavage planes typically intersect at 60°, 90°, or 120° angles to straight angles. When observing flat surfaces on minerals, keep in mind that not all of them are cleavage planes.
The tendency of a material to fracture on flat planar surfaces depends on the mineral's crystal structure. These two-dimensional surfaces, referred to as cleavage planes, are produced by the alignment of atoms with weaker interactions within the crystal lattice.

The thermocline in the ocean is a layer that signifies a density change due to temperature, where warmer water sits over colder water, creating a stable, stratified environment.
Explanation:
The thermocline is a layer in the ocean that represents a density change due to temperature. This layer is characterized by a temperature that is significantly different from that of the surrounding layers, usually warmer water at the top and colder water below.
As the wind stirs the upper layers, it creates a mixed layer at the surface with constant temperature and salinity. Below this mixed layer is the thermocline, typically between about 200 - 1000 m depth, where the temperature decreases rapidly with depth, leading to an increase in water density. This temperature-driven density change is crucial for the ocean's vertical structure and affects oceanic currents and marine life distribution.

An island arc forms where oceanic crust collides with oceanic crust. The collision leads to subduction, where the denser plate goes underneath the other. The subduction process causes volcanic activity that creates a chain of islands known as an island arc.
Explanation:An island arc refers to a string of volcanic islands that typically form in the ocean due to tectonic plate activities, specifically at subduction zones. These zones are areas where one tectonic plate is forced to dive or 'subduct' beneath another plate. An island arc specifically forms where oceanic crust collides with oceanic crust.
When this collision occurs, the denser of the two plates sinks beneath the other in the mantle, forming a deep-sea trench. The subducted crust then begins to melt due to the intense heat and pressure in the mantle. This melting generates magma, which rises to the surface and creates a chain of volcanoes. Over time, repeated volcanic eruptions lead to the emergence and growth of islands above the sea surface, hence forming an island arc.
